Transaction 169aa45611768018c5d852cc24c598592119db95d062e2fdfd5e16d594f05245
1 Input
1 Output
-
169aa45611768018c5d852cc24c598592119db95d062e2fdfd5e16d594f05245:0
- value
- 654690
- script pubkey
- OP_0 OP_PUSHBYTES_20 37671295b5e0e1b670aedcb9de95757da7b9e26b
- address
- bc1qxan399d4ursmvu9wmjuaa9t40knmncnt3t2khz